Key Points:

The Struggle is Real: Motherhood is hard, but God meets us in the mess (Psalm 127:3, John 16:33).

Reframe Your Work: Every act of love for your family is worship to God (Colossians 3:23).

Pause for Strength: Take small moments to breathe in God’s truth (Isaiah 40:31).

Joy is a Gift: It’s a fruit of the Spirit, grown as we abide in Him (Galatians 5:22-23).

Key Points:

The Anxiety Rut: Daily stress (kids, chores, chaos) + toxic family (guilt trips, drama) = overwhelm that traps you.

God’s Promise: His peace and strength can lift you out (Philippians 4:6-7).

Three Steps to Freedom:

Simplify the Stress – Let go of one thing (like a big meal for paper plates) to lighten the load.
Set a Clear Boundary – Tell toxic family, “I can’t now—later,” protecting your peace.
Rely on God’s Strength – Pray and reset to climb out of the rut.
